Hi Folks

I toss all the cage trash (old, half-eaten milkweed leaves and stems, plus the papers or paper towels that were underneath), into a paper bag that I keep for a week or so. Then I dump it out and check all the leaves again. I usually find at least one little caterpillar that I mistakenly threw away but which is now big enough to see.
